Bellerose Childrenswear Ads Take Cues from Jeans Campaigns for Grown-Ups

The new ads for Bellerose Childrenswear are taking cues from adult denim ads, featuring the backs of topless boy models strutting their toddler bums. The ads are funny in a cute innocent way. The denim actually looks pretty good on the toddlers, even with the bulk of their diapers.

The Bellerose Childrenswear ads are modeling their "Denim for kids" line, which boasts denim for all sizes of little ones. I'm intrigued as to how well these ads will attract attention to the company; some people could find it a little odd.
